Output 51b7832e230e156e4826ecd478c98ec329265b6e511ac30055a17720ad954b97:10

value
17584637
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 de4ab1d05b8c446953cc6043805c9c81713700428771a8239e30797c308ce1a5
address
tb1pme9tr5zm33zxj57vvppcqhyus9cnwqzzsac6sgu7xpuhcvyvuxjsexnsau
transaction
51b7832e230e156e4826ecd478c98ec329265b6e511ac30055a17720ad954b97
spent
true